摘要
Single stage anaerobic digestion (AD) is a process comprised of distinct stages, each with specific optimal conditions for the microbial communities involved. In this study, the AD process of rice straw (RS) was divided into two-phase (TP), two-stage (TS) and three-stage (ThS) systems by adjusting hydraulic retention time (HRT) to enhance the biomethane yield. Following system stabilization, the parameters of different stage were adjusted. The result showed that the biogas production of TP, TS and ThS systems was 26.4 %, 9.0 % and 10.4 % higher than single-stage system. Furthermore, after thermal adjustment, the biomethane production in TP, TS and ThS systems increased by 12.6 %, 17.6 % and 28.2 %, respectively. Metagenomic analysis revealed inhibition of CO2 and methyl methanogenesis in TP1 and ThS1, and multi-stage AD divided the AD process into different functional stages. The function of polysaccharide degradation and microbial activity were enhanced by staged regulation. Thus, the multi-stage AD is a promising strategy for enhancing biomethane production from RS, and judicious regulation of parameters can further improve AD performance.
